CE QU’IL Y A POUR VOUS • Joignez-vous à un chef de file du secteur et façonnez l’avenir de l’immobilier commercial • Des Investissements massifs dans les technologies de pointe afin d’optimiser votre travail • Régime d’avantages sociaux complet et concurrentiel • Un milieu de travail stimulant, conçu pour votre croissance et votre bien-être English Senior Project Manager JLL is currently seeking a dynamic individual for the role of Senior Project Manager to provide reliable, timely, and professional support to the Project Team, leading day to day project management activities for major capital projects in the public and private sectors. This is an important “client-facing” role that requires heightened situational awareness, diplomacy, sensitivity, and a solid business acumen. Our successful candidate will be a confident communicator, with the gravitas to liaise with a range of professionals and business partners. The Project Manager will be interacting directly with clients fully accountable for JLL’s performance in the delivery of project. This position will require the ability to exhibit independent judgment to proactively plan, prioritize, and organize a diverse team and workload in a fast-paced environment. Our successful candidate will bring commitment, energy and a passion for a fast paced and dynamic industry. WHAT YOU’LL DO Ensuring projects are completed within scope, schedule, budget, and meeting client expectations. Managing multiple projects in various phases of development. Negotiating and holding all parties accountable to their contracts. Managing and coordinating the activities of large project teams including owners, regional and local design consultants, contractors, suppliers, AHJs, security, AV and IT vendors, operators, and other stakeholders. Coordinating between base building and tenant improvement scope and negotiating with landlords. Developing, implementing and maintaining specified project management processes. Proactively communicating with your client; maintaining project status and tracking reports. Detailed financial and schedule management and reporting. Utilizing a custom project management platform/technology. Leading project meetings: ensuring minutes are quickly distributed and properly filed. Proactively foreseeing and documenting project risks and risk mitigation plans. Actively troubleshooting, problem solving and tracking project performance indicators. Managing JLL’s financial performance per project. Fostering a project environment of accountability, excellence, inclusivity, collaboration, and innovation. Cultivating new and existing business relationships. Collaborating with JLL peers, partners and clients. Building trust with owners, landlords, developers, institutions, consultants, and contractors. Leading pursuit strategy, sourcing, positioning, proposing, and securing of new projects. Strategically networking and positioning JLL as a leader in project management services. WHAT WE’RE LOOKING FOR 10+ years of local experience pursuing and delivering capital “buildings” projects, including new construction, renovations, fit-outs, and/or upgrades. Possess “Owner Representative” project management experience working directly for a Client in a fee-for-service consulting business environment. Led major capital projects of $2M+ from inception to completion without supervision Corporate Office Tenant Improvements experience Demonstrated client relationship management skills Strong analytical skills and solution development Outstanding organizational and time management skills Expert verbal and written communication skills Attention to detail and ability to drive consistency in a team or on a project Computer proficiency in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Adobe and Microsoft Project Scheduling, estimating, cost control experience Ability to excel in a fast-paced and demanding environment Travel as needed per project Bilingual ENG/FR Preferred Attributes Project Management, Engineering, Architecture, or similar education is an asset. P.Eng. or similar professional designation is an asset. Project Management Professional (PMP) is an asset. Sustainability designation such as LEED, CSP, ENV SP is an asset. Excellent interpersonal skills; articulate, responsive, and highly organized. Skilled at MS Office suite of software (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) Experience with MS Project or other scheduling software is an asset.
